Managing stress is an essential part of any successful management career. It can be difficult to stay focused and motivated when faced with challenging situations, but having the right strategies and tools in place can make all the difference. Stress is a common experience in everyday life and can be caused by various factors, such as work, relationships, finances, health, and other life events. However, it's important to manage stress to prevent it from negatively affecting our physical and mental health. One way to manage stress is through self-care. Self-care is about taking intentional actions to improve our physical, emotional, and mental well-being. Self-care is an important aspect of stress management, and this guide provides the essential information and advice to help you take the necessary steps to reduce stress levels and increase your productivity. From understanding the importance of regular breaks to learning how to prioritize tasks, this guide covers the essential topics to help managers make a successful transition to a more stress-free work environment Such as:
- Engaging in physical activity:
- How to Practice mindfulness and meditation:
- Engaging in activities you enjoy: How to prioritize Task to reduce Stress
- How to create a self free management plan.
- Self-care Resources for everyone.
With the right knowledge and resources, managers can better manage stress and make their workday more productive and enjoyable.
Christopher Keith was born on June 16, 1979, in Piedmont, California, and grew up in the San Francisco Bay Area. He obtained his Bachelor of Arts degree in psychology from Pepperdine University and his doctorate in psychology from Sierra University.
Keith is also a popular motivational speaker and has conducted seminars and workshops on stress management and personal growth, which exposes his understanding of the struggles that individuals face when trying to manage stress. He provides practical tools and strategies for managing stress, as well as emotional support and encouragement for those who are struggling with high stress levels.
His book " Overcoming Stress Through Self Care" provides you with the essential information you need to successfully transition to a life and workplace that is less stressful, including how to prioritize tasks and comprehend the significance of taking frequent breaks.
Christopher Keith is married to Thelma Keith and they are blessed with two beautiful children.
